The experiment was established in the experimental field at the experimental field in Leskovac (Serbia) during the three growing seasons. The objective of this study was to investigate the influence of genotype and environment on the yield of winter barley cultivars (Nonius, Bc Srećko and Bc Bosut). The following characteristics were analysed: grain yield, 1000 grain weight and test weight. The grain yield of winter barley significantly varied across years, from 3.463 t/ha in 2021/22 to 4.971 t/ha in 2020/21. The highest yield, 1000 grain weight and test weight in all barley varieties were in the first vegetation period with moderate temperatures at the time of grain filling and a large amount of precipitation. The average yield during the three-year trial, for all examined barley varieties in the study was 4.454 t/ha. The highest three-year average of grain yield (4.701 t/ha) were obtained by Nonius cultivar. The average 1000 grain weight in the study was 46.31 g. The test weight for ...all examined barley varieties in the study was 60.52 kg/hl.
Analysis of variance revealed a highly significant effect of the growing season on all studied traits of barley. A highly significant effect of genotype on 1000 grain weight was determined. Correlation coefficients showed large variations, which results from the interaction between the properties within each genotype and genotype interactions with environmental factors.
